Tom Postma Design, in cooperation with the Engineering Department of the Municipality of Greater Amman, completed designs for the 11 August Street 'Cultural Avenue' project in Amman's Shmeisani district for the Municipality of Greater Amman. The refurbishment of the 360 meter-long street includes the design of landscaping, paving, street furniture, as well as the construction of cultural and tourist landmarks on both sides of the street, including a summer theater for musical performances. The project, which is part of the Municipality of Greater Amman's preparations for the Amman Arab Cultural Capital 2002 celebrations, is set for completion in April 2002.

Dar al-Omran
, in association with the American interior and graphic design firm Arrowstreet, completed designs for the permanent campus of al-Hussein Bin Talal University in Ma'an, Jordan. The designs include a master plan for the 3.2 square-kilometer university campus, designs for 199,000 square meters of built-up areas, as well as design studies for infrastructure and agricultural works. The project is expected to cost 82 million JD (117 million $US).
Dar al-Omran, in association with the American interior and graphic design firm Arrowstreet, completed designs for the Fahaheel Waterfront development project in Kuwait. The 32,000 square-meter, 1,600 meter-long waterfront project is owned by the Tamdeen Real Estate Company and is expected to cost 37 million JD (around 53 million $US).

Bitar Consultants
is one of six consulting firms that have been commissioned to design the Aqaba New Islamic Hospital for the Islamic Center Society in Aqaba. The 30,000 square-meter project is estimated to cost 9 million JD (around 13 million $US).

Bilal Hammad Associates
, Dr. Yaghmour and Associates Consulting Architects, and Tahhan and Bushnaq Architects, completed a joint design for the Sweimeh National Park in Sweimeh, along the Dead Sea, for the Jordanian Ministry of Tourism and Antiquities. The 3 kilometer-square project extends 3 kilometers along the seashore, and includes picnic areas, restaurants, and play areas.
